Petrogress, Inc. Reports Earnings Results for the Full Year Ended December 31, 2018

Petrogress, Inc. announced earnings results for the full year ended December 31, 2018. For the full year, the company announced sales was USD 9.026 million compared to USD 9.163 million a year ago. Operating income was USD 329,368 compared to USD 274,871 a year ago. Net income was USD 307,047 compared to USD 294,669 a year ago. Basic earnings per share was USD 0.0894 compared to USD 0.1696 a year ago. Diluted earnings per share was USD 0.0896 compared to USD 0.1696 a year ago.
Petrogress, Inc., formerly 800 Commerce, Inc., is a holding company. The Company, along with its subsidiaries, is engaged in international trading and shipping business. The Company is engaged in exploring the potential for acquiring or purchasing or leasing newly built liquefied natural gas (LNG) vessels in the United States to be used for the supply and sea freight of the United States LNG exports. The Company's subsidiary, Petrogres Co. Ltd. (Petrogres), operates as an oil commodity company in West Africa. Its other subsidiaries are Petronav Carriers LLC (Petronav) and Petrogress Oil & Gas Energy Inc. (Petrogress Energy). Petronav focuses on primarily managing the day-to-day operation and handling of the tanker fleet it manages. Petrogress Energy is primarily focused on investigating the feasibility of acquiring oil fields in Texas so that the Company can expand its operations into the LNG market within the United States market.
